Everything that we bought was delicious. We got a few savory types: turkey pot pie, kalua pork curry pan, and a ham and potato roll. We also tried quite a few of the sweet ones: custard filled and chocolate filled. Everything was great! My favorites were the custard filled and the kalua pork curry.

Brug Bakery is a US Bakery based in Aiea, Hawaii. Brug Bakery is located at 98 - 1005 Moanalua Rd, Aiea, HI 96701, USA.
